POSITION SUMMARY:
Fellowship position to train with child psychiatry staff and pediatric & psychiatry mentors to become a clinician and researcher in pediatric behavioral health.
Position: Children and Family focused Community based Postdoctoral Fellow
Department: Psychiatry
Schedule: Full Time
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ES / DUTIES:
Characteristics of normal and abnormal child development
Comprehensive psychiatric diagnostic evaluation of children and adolescents
Differential diagnosis of child and adolescent psychiatric disorders
Bio/psychosocial clinical formulation
Comprehensive treatment planning
Evidence-based treatments for child and adolescent psychiatric disorders
Utilizing child-serving systems that interface with children and adolescents experiencing psychiatric disorders
Appropriate use of standardized symptom rating scales
Cultural competence
Utilization management and quality improvement initiatives
Clinical documentation using electronic format
Compliance with regulatory agency requirements
Appropriate billing for clinical services
Collaboration with medical professionals
Standards of care in child and adolescent psychiatry
Gain knowledge and experience in the following research skills:
Quantitative and qualitative research design and methodology
Statistical analysis and interpretation
Literature search methodology and bias ratings of extant literature
Gain knowledge and experience in the following teaching skills:
Teaching evidence-based therapy to clinical social workers
Teaching child & adolescent psychopathology and evidence-based management to primary care physicians and residents
